I just booked my wedding at Zedler's Mill in Luling, and the place is fantastic! Only $1000 for a weekend or $500 on weekdays, tables and chairs included, GORGEOUS stone amphitheater by the river for the wedding and a pavilion for the reception with garage-style doors you can open in nice weather, huge kitchen, bride's room... this place has EVERYTHING.

I've been looking for venues in the New Braunfels all the way up to Austin area for a while. My finace and I would like outdoor with an indoor option. We're also not opposed to offseason and Friday/Sunday dates. Our venue budget however is around 1500 but everywhere we've seen is at least 2,000 or so. Does anyone have any ideas on parks or other maybe non-traditional "wedding venues" that can be used. It's a small ceremony(50ish) so we just don't want to spend 2,000+ on the venue alone.
